An Volvo EC210 VECU: Exploring Engine Control
Wiki Article
The Volvo EC210 excavator is a powerful machine, acknowledged for its performance and reliability. At the heart of this power lies the Volvo Electronic Control Unit, or VECU. This sophisticated electronic system plays a vital role in managing and optimizing the engine's performance, ensuring smooth operation, fuel efficiency, and reduced emissions.
- Understanding the VECU's functionalities allows operators to maximize the excavator's full potential.
- Fundamental parameters like fuel injection timing, boost, and exhaust gas recirculation are precisely controlled by the VECU.
- Additionally, the VECU integrates with other units on the excavator to assess performance in real-time, modifying engine parameters as needed for optimal operation under diverse working conditions.
Via its complex algorithms and input devices, the VECU provides a consistent power delivery experience, making the Volvo EC210 an exceptional choice for demanding excavation tasks.

Understanding the Volvo EC290's ECU System unit
The Volvo EC290 excavator boasts impressive performance and reliability, largely thanks to its sophisticated Electronic Control Unit (ECU). This key component acts as the command center for the machine, orchestrating a complex network of sensors and actuators to ensure smooth and efficient operation. By processing data from various sources, the ECU determines engine parameters such as fuel injection, turbocharger boost, and hydraulic pressure, maximizing power output while reducing emissions and fuel consumption.
Understanding the intricacies of the EC290's ECU design can be invaluable for technicians conducting maintenance and identifying potential issues. A detailed grasp of its functionality allows for more effective repairs, optimizing the excavator's overall lifespan and performance.
